Mailcatch.app Alternatives
Mailcatch.app is described as 'An email sandbox to inspect and debug emails in dev, staging, and QA environments before sending them to recipients in production' and is an website. There are more than 10 alternatives to Mailcatch.app, not only websites but also apps for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Linux, SaaS and Mac apps. The best Mailcatch.app alternative is Mailpit, which is both free and Open Source. Other great sites and apps similar to Mailcatch.app are MailHog, Papercut, FakeSMTP and Mailtrap.

MailHog is an email testing tool inspired by MailCatcher, but easier to install.
DiscontinuedThe last version (1.0.1) is from August 2020, and the project is unmaintained. https://github.com/mailhog/MailHog/issues/442

Papercut is a simplified SMTP server designed to only receive messages (not to send them on) with a GUI on top of it allowing you to see the messages it receives.

FakeSMTP is a Free Fake SMTP Server with GUI for testing emails in applications easily. It is written in Java.

Dummy SMTP server that sits in the system tray and does not deliver the received messages. The received messages can be quickly viewed, saved and the source/structure inspected. Useful for testing/debugging software that generates email.
